Open on Wednesdays and Saturdays from 9 am until 12 pm, the Thrift Shop serves the local community by offering gently used donated clothing and household goods at affordable prices. All of the income earned by the Thrift Shop is donated to the wider community. For nearly 45 years the proceeds from Thrift Shop sales have been used for charitable purposes. Emmaus House and Mitch’s Place in Haverhill, Lazarus House in Lawrence, the Groveland Council on Aging, Pettengill Place in Salisbury and several other local agencies are the programs we support. All of the items sold in the Thrift Shop are donated by community members and the shop is completely run by volunteers.

We are happy to accept your donations of gently used items. There is a large drop off bin outside the shop where you can leave your donation.
